Irresistible Cinnamon Brown Butter Cookies Ingredients

For the Dough

  • Unsalted Butter – Provides richness and creaminess; essential for browning to enhance flavor. Substitute with plant-based butter for a dairy-free option.
  • Granulated Sugar – Adds sweetness and helps cookies spread; no direct substitutions, as it’s essential for the texture.
  • Brown Sugar – Contributes to moisture and chewy texture; enhances caramel notes. Can be replaced with coconut sugar for a lower glycemic index.
  • Eggs – Binds the ingredients and adds moisture; crucial for structure; use flax eggs as a vegan substitute.
  • All-Purpose Flour – Provides structure; essential for creating the cookie dough. Substitute with a gluten-free flour blend for gluten-free cookies.
  • Ground Cinnamon – Adds warmth and a classic cookie flavor; feel free to use other spices like nutmeg or allspice for variation.
  • Baking Soda – A leavening agent that helps the cookies rise; do not use baking powder without adjusting the recipe.
  • Salt – Enhances flavors and balances sweetness; omit if you’re using salted butter.

How to Make Irresistible Cinnamon Brown Butter Cookies

  1. Prepare Ingredients: Start by gathering all your ingredients together.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per, ensuring a hassle-free baking experience.

  2. Brown the Butter: Melt the unsalted butter in a saucepan over medium heat. Stir occasionally until it becomes golden brown and emits a nutty aroma, about 5-7 minutes. This is where the magic begins!

  3. Mix Sugars and Eggs: In a large mixing bowl, blend the browned butter with both granulated and brown sugars. Beat in the eggs, one at a time, until the mixture is smooth and velvety.

  4. Combine Dry Ingredients: In a separate b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, ground cinnamon, baking soda, and salt. Slowly add this dry mix to the wet ingredients, stirring until just combined to keep the dough light and fluffy.

  5. Scoop and Bake: Using a cookie scoop, drop spoonfuls of dough onto your prepared baking sheet, leaving space between each one. B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are golden brown but the centers remain soft.

  6. Cool Down: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for about 5 minutes before transferring them to wire racks. Let them cool completely, or sneak a warm cookie to feel that delightful chewiness!

Optional: Drizzle with melted chocolate for an indulgent touch.

Expert Tips for Irresistible Cinnamon Brown Butter Cookies

  • Chill Dough: Let the dough rest in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es to improve texture and enhance flavor.
  • Uniform Size: Use a cookie scoop to ensure each cookie bakes evenly and has that perfect chewy center.
  • Mix Gently: Avoid overmixing the dough; stirring until just combined helps your cookies stay soft and tender.
  • Baking Time: Keep a close eye on your cookies; remove them from the oven when the edges are golden and the centers are still soft to get that irresistible gooeyness.
  • Store Properly: Keep your c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week or freeze for later enjoyment.

Storage Tips for Irresistible Cinnamon Brown Butter Cookies

  • Room Temperature: Keep c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 1 week to maintain freshness and chewiness.
  • Fridge: For extended freshness, store in the refrigerator in an airtight container for up to 2 weeks, although the texture may slightly change.
  • Freezer: Freeze the cookies in a single layer before transferring them to a freezer-safe bag for up to 3 months. Make sure to label the bag with the date!
  • Reheating: To enjoy that freshly baked feel, warm cookies in the microwave for about 10 seconds before serving or pop them in a preheated oven for a few minutes.

Make Ahead Options

These Irresistible Cinnamon Brown Butter Cookies are perfect for meal prep enthusiasts! You can prepare the dough up to 24 hours in advance; simply mix all the ingredients and chill the dough in the refrigerator. To maintain their delightful chewiness, make sure to wrap the dough tightly in plastic wrap. If you prefer, you can also freeze the dough for up to 3 months—just scoop the dough onto a baking sheet, flash freeze it, and then transfer to an airtight container. When you’re ready to bake, there’s no need to thaw; simply add a couple of extra minutes to the baking time for fresh cookies anytime! Irresistible Cinnamon Brown Butter Cookies Recipe FAQs

What type of butter should I use for the best flavor?
Absolutely! Unsalted butter is ideal for these cookies as it allows you to control the saltiness. Browning the butter is critical to enhance its nutty flavor, which is a hallmark of these irresistible Cinnamon Brown Butter Cookies. If you’re looking for a dairy-free alternative, consider using a high-quality plant-based butter.

How can I ensure my cookies stay soft after baking?
Very! To keep those delectable cookies soft, it’s essential not to overbake them. Bake until the edges are golden brown, and the centers still look slightly underdone. Additionally, allowing the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ack helps retain moisture while they firm up outside the oven.

What’s the best way to store my cookies to maintain freshness?
I often recommend storing your c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. To keep them even fresher for longer, refrigerate them in a sealed container for up to two weeks. However, you might notice a slight change in texture. If you intend to keep them even longer, freeze them! Just place them in a single layer on a baking sheet until firm, then transfer to a freezer-safe bag for up to three months.

Can I freeze the cookie dough to bake later?
Absolutely! You can freeze the cookie dough for later use. Scoop the dough onto a baking sheet and freeze it in individual portions until solid. Afterward, transfer the frozen dough balls to a freezer-safe bag, labeling it with the date. When you’re ready to bake, there’s no need to thaw; just add a couple of extra minutes to the baking time.

What should I do if my cookies spread too much?
The more the merrier when it comes to troubleshooting! If your cookies spread too much during baking, it could be due to warm dough. Chill the dough for at least 30 minutes before scooping and baking. Additionally, ensure that you’re using the proper flour measurements—too little can lead to a flatter cookie. Using a cookie scoop can also help maintain uniform shape!

Are there any dietary considerations I should keep in mind?
Well, you should definitely consider that the recipe contains eggs and gluten, which are common allergens. For a vegan option, substitute flax eggs for regular eggs (one flax egg equals 1 tablespoon ground flaxseed mixed with 2.5 tablespoons of water). If anyone has a gluten intolerance, using a gluten-free flour blend can yield delicious results. Always double-check each ingredient label if you have specific dietary needs!

Irresistible Cinnamon Brown Butter Cookies You'll Crave Daily

These Irresistible Cinnamon Brown Butter Cookies are a delightful blend of chewy and crisp textures, perfect for any occasion.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 12 minutes
Chilling Time 30 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 2 minutes
Servings: 24 cookies
Course: DESSERTS
Cuisine: American
Calories: 150

Ingredients
  

For the Dough
  • 1 cup Unsalted Butter Provides richness and creaminess; essential for browning to enhance flavor.
  • 1 cup Granulated Sugar Adds sweetness and helps cookies spread; no direct substitutions.
  • 1 cup Brown Sugar Contributes to moisture and chewy texture; enhances caramel notes.
  • 2 large Eggs Binds the ingredients and adds moisture; crucial for structure.
  • 2.5 cups All-Purpose Flour Provides structure; essential for creating the cookie dough.
  • 2 teaspoons Ground Cinnamon Adds warmth and a classic cookie flavor.
  • 1 teaspoon Baking Soda A leavening agent that helps the cookies rise.
  • 0.5 teaspoon Salt Enhances flavors and balances sweetness; omit if using salted butter.

Equipment

  • Mixing bowl
  • Saucepan
  • baking sheet
  • Parchment Paper
  • Cookie Scoop

Method
 

Baking Instructions
  1. Prepare Ingredients: Start by gathering all your ingredients together.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. Brown the Butter: Melt the unsalted butter in a saucepan over medium heat until golden brown and nutty, about 5-7 minutes.
  3. Mix Sugars and Eggs: Blend the browned butter with both sugars, then beat in the eggs until smooth.
  4. Combine Dry Ingredients: Whisk together flour, cinnamon, baking soda, and salt. Slowly mix into the wet ingredients until combined.
  5. Scoop and Bake: Drop spoonfuls of dough onto the baking sheet, leaving space in between. Bake for 10-12 minutes.
  6. Cool Down: Allow cookies to c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ring to wire racks.
